Webinar on “Strengthening Global Health Security at the Human and Animal Interface”: September 19, 2022
September 19, 2022

MPH Programme, Department of Health Policy, PSPH, organized a webinar on “Strengthening Global Health Security at the Human and Animal Interface” on Monday, September 19, 2022.
Dr N Devadasan, Public Health Specialist, Adjunct Faculty- Institute of Public Health, Bengaluru; Dr Nagappa S Karabasanavar, Associate Professor and Head, Department of Veterinary Public Health and Epidemiology, Veterinary College, Hassan and Dr Shafeeq K Shahul Hameed Scientific Officer, Centre for Brain Research, Indian Institute of Science, Bengaluru; MPH Alumnus, [2010-2012 batch] were the resource persons. The topic discussed were Health Systems Response to Zoonotic Disease and The Role of Veterinary Services in Zoonotic Disease Preparedness.
